Digital colour guidelines
Primary brand colours
#E80F42
R232 G15 B66
Pantone 192 C
Use for primary buttons like "Book a free consultation" and key call-to-action elements
Apply to icons, small graphic elements, and text highlights that require attention
Use in sections where an attention-grabbing background is necessary without overwhelming
the user
#FFFFFF
R255 G255 B255
Use for the main content areas and sections to create a clean and modern look
Apply to text placed on dark backgrounds, such as button text or over Midnight Black elements
#1F2733
R31 G39 B51
Pantone 7547 C
Use for body text, headlines, and subheadings to ensure readability
Apply to footer backgrounds, button backgrounds, and elements that need contrast against lighter sections.
